What Is a Portable Scanner?

A portable scanner is a small, lightweight gadget that is meant to scan documents, photos, receipts, ID cards, and other hard-copy files in digital formats at the same time. In contrast to the ancient flatbed or bulky office scanners, the portable scanners are compact, easy to carry, and can be charged by either USB or rechargeable batteries. They work well with professionals, students, and businesses that require scanning solutions but not within a fixed office system.

However, a desktop scanner needs space, installation, and even technical support, whereas a portable scanner is flexible, fast, and movable. An example is that a lawyer can scan the contracts at the time of a client meeting, or a student can scan the notes in the library. These are some of the characteristics that make the portable document scanner a necessary device in the modern mobile and digital-first environment.

Types of Portable Scanners

The portable scanners are not all similar – not all types apply to the same purpose. Their categories are useful to understand and identify the correct device.

Portable Document Scanner

The most popular is the portable document scanner. It is created to scan multiple-page contracts, invoices, and comprehensive reports. Lots of models have such features as Optical Character Recognition (OCR), which is why scanned text is searchable and editable.

These scanners are not as small as pocket scanners but can still fit in a briefcase. Financial practitioners, legal and education professionals all make heavy use of them. 

Best Buy – When needed by businesses and professionals who constantly need to deal with several pages or official documents and need high-resolution scans.

Portable Page Scanner

The portable page scanner is thinner and is designed to scan a sheet at a time. These gadgets feed a page under the scanner, hence are handy in activities involving a single page.

As an example, a teacher may look at a student’s assignment without scanning it in a few seconds, or a healthcare worker may look at an ID card or even a prescription and scan it. They are quicker than pocket scanners and might not be able to deal with bulk jobs such as document scanners.

Best Buy – The users should have a lightweight and fast scanning of one-page files, contracts, or identification papers.

Portable Pocket Scanner

The smallest type is the pocket scanner that can be held in the pocket. They are very small gadgets that fit in a bag, and maybe even a pocket; they are ideal when scanning a receipt, a note, a small document, or an ID card.

Pocket scanners are cheap, and this feature appeals to individuals or small entrepreneurs who desire an entry-level device. They might not be as sophisticated as bigger scanners are, but they are portable and convenient.

Best Buy – Travelers, students, and freelancers who need to scan small documents at a fast pace (when on the go).

Key Features to Look for in a Portable Scanner

When you are planning to purchase a portable scanner, consideration of the appropriate features is a sure way of making an intelligent investment. An excellent device must be portable, performance-wise, and affordable. The following are the key aspects that should be remembered –

  • Resolution & Image Quality – Resolution is a value in DPI (dots per inch), and the higher the value, the sharper your scans are going to be. A desktop scanner of 600 DPI should be quite adequate to do all the daily activities, whereas a professional who works with contracts, graphics, or fine print must consider a higher resolution.
  • Connectivity Options – Numerous scanners of today are equipped with USB, Wi-Fi, or Bluetooth. A Wi-Fi scanner will enable direct transfer to the cloud or mobile devices in real-time, so it is convenient to use with remote employees and companies with numerous users.
  • Portability & Battery Life – The advantage of a portable page scanner or a portable pocket scanner is mainly mobility. Find portable tools that have good rechargeable batteries and can go through a few scanning sessions without charging up regularly.
  • File Compatibility – A scanner must be able to save files with various formats, such as PDF, JPG, or text with the OCR features. OCR (Optical Character Recognition) is especially useful since it translates scanned text into the form of editable and searchable text.
  • Speed & Storage Capacity – Speed will be important, provided you are scanning in bulk. The portable document scanner with a speed of 8-15 pages per minute is cost-effective for small companies. Other models come with an inbuilt storage or SD card, which comes in handy during scanning outside the computer.

Benefits of Using Portable Scanners

Thinking to buy portable scanner is not merely a convenience – it is a productivity booster. Among the best advantages, there are –

  • On-the-Go Convenience – A pocket scanner can be carried in a bag and taken anywhere. It also enables professionals as well as students to scan documents immediately without having to travel back to the office.
  • Paperless Workflow – The use of a portable scanner for documents helps to decrease the tendency to use paper. Digital files are simpler to arrange, compare, and exchange, and a tidy environment is achieved.
  • Cost & Time Savings – People and businesses can do minor scanning tasks themselves instead of subcontracting them. This saves money and time wastage in the process of waiting to have third-party services.
  • Better Security – Those files scanned by means of safe programs are encrypted and secured by a password, which means that the sensitive data remains safe.
  • Versatility – Receipts and contracts, ID cards and handwritten notes, various kinds of portable page scanners and pocket scanners can be used to perform various tasks.
  • Improved Organization – Record management is smooth with the scanners that have OCR features, and you can quickly search, edit, and classify documents.
